Summary:
for the first time in a single volume, Jean Paul Barbier, a world-renowned historian, presents numerous "vanished civilizations" in a synthesis that plunges us deep into past worlds. Through beautiful and lavish photographs, Vanished Civilizations: From the Ancients to Easter Island invites you to discover such mysteries as the world of the Etruscans; the meaning of the Pascuan island's heads; the art of the Celts; the Olmec and the dawn of Mexican art; the grandeur and decadence of the Maya; and the mystical North American Indians.
